One of the biggest nights of the UFC year takes place this weekend, as the main card for the UFC 253 event promises to be one of the most exciting.
The main event will see two undefeated stars go head to head, as Israel Adesanya defends his middleweight championship against Paulo Costa. It is one of the most eagely-anticipated bouts of the year, and should be one of the best fights of the year so far.
Dominick Reyes also faces off against Jan Blachowicz on the card, while Kai Kara-France and Brandon Royval also go toe-to-toe. However, there are also some intriguing fights for fights fans to look forward to on the Preliminary Card.
UFC News: Brad Riddell Takes On Alex da Silva Coelho
The final match on the Preliminary Card will see Brad Riddell take on Alex da Silva Coelho. Both fighters have outstanding professional records, and a victory for either could see the catapult through the lightweight rankings.
Riddell has lost just twice in his professional career, but has won his last five. His UFC debut came 12 months ago as he beat Jamie Mullarkey via unanimous decision.
Coelho provides an excellent opponent for Riddell, as he has lost just twice in 22 professional bouts. However, one of those defeats came last year, as he was beaten by Alexander Yakovlev on his UFC debut via submission.
However, he bounced back to win his first fight in UFC against Rodrigo Vargas less than four months later. This will be an exciting fight between these two dynamic athletes.
UFC News: Other Notable Preliminary Card Bouts
There are two other standout fights during the prelims, with Diego Sanchez taking on Jake Matthews. Sanchez has a record of 31-12-0, and comes into this welterweight bout having lost just once in his last four. His last victory came against Michel Pereira in February. Meanwhile, Matthews has lost just four times in 20 fights, and has won his last two.
There is also an interesting fight on the prelims between Shane Young and Ludovit Klein. Klein has lost just two fights during his professional career, and has won on 16 occasions.
Meanwhile, Young has won on 13 occasions and lost four times. This fight could go either way, but it does ensure that MMA fans will be glued to their screens throughout the evening on Saturday.
